ÆR & Komorebi – A Musical Journey of Light and Sound We are delighted to welcome the exceptional trio Peltomaa Fraanje Perkola for a unique concert experience that transcends genres and centuries. Hailing from Finland and the Netherlands, the trio weaves together the delicate sounds of medieval harp, viola da gamba, piano, voice, and electronic effects into a deeply personal and evocative soundscape. PELTOMAA FRAANJE PERKOLA (Finland, Netherlands) Aino Peltomaa – voice, medieval harp Harmen Fraanje – piano, synthesizer Mikko Perkola – viola da gamba and effects Their music draws inspiration from early music, jazz, Finnish folk, and contemporary traditions, with medieval music at its heart. Following their acclaimed debut ÆR (2021), the ensemble presents Komorebi – a poetic homage to the Japanese word describing “sunlight filtering through the leaves,” evoking the interplay between nature, light, and emotion.
